# Driftway Environments

Driftway handles mobile deep-link routing for all Pellicorn apps. We run three environments: sandbox, staging, and production. Each has its own link domain and routing table; never point a test build at production, as redirects are cached aggressively downstream. The staging environment's active configuration is reproduced below for reference.

settings of tagef-bawif:
DRUIX_HOST=druix.zemvarlabs.internal
DRUIX_PORT=8000

# Support Outsourcing Plan — Managers Only

From Q3, tier-one support for the Bravano product line transitions to Quillhaven Services, our partner in Dorvale. Tier-two and escalations remain in-house under Petra Lindqvist. Sales leads should route customer concerns through the standard escalation form and avoid confirming timelines externally. Training overlap runs six weeks. Strategic context for this decision follows below.

board note of kajeg-taduf: The pricing group signed off on a budget of $23.8 million for Project Istys. The renewal with Norwynix Group closes at $56.9 million a year, 52 percent above the last contract.

Minutes, management meeting — Calloway Fixtures. Present: operations, finance, warehouse leads. Agreed: write down obsolete Norbeck shelving stock held at the Tellford depot. Impact booked this quarter; auditors notified. Action: clearance sale via outlet channel by month-end. Residual scrap handled by site team. Board approval requested at next session. The write-down connects to a broader direction the board should understand.

board note of bawep-tajef: Queniusek Systems plans to raise the Quenvan list price by 53.1 percent in March. The pricing group signed off on a budget of $176.4 million for Project Drueth. The renewal with Casionix Partners closes at $142.5 million a year, 8.3 percent below the last contract. Project Fraax slips by six weeks because of the tooling delay.

## Deploying the Gatewick Proctor Queue

Deploys are pretty painless: push to main, wait for the pipeline, then watch the queue drain dashboard for five minutes. If candidates pile up mid-exam, roll back first and ask questions later — the queue replays safely. Everything the workers care about lives in one config block, shown here for reference.

settings of bafof-yagef:
JOROX_PIN=8740
JOROX_TENANT=pelox
JOROX_METRICS_HOST=metrics.jorox.qorvelworks.internal
JOROX_SEAL=seal_c78f63c1
JOROX_STANDBY_TEAM=norax